Mobile network operator AirtelTigo has introduced another offer for its customers.
The network is giving its customers the ‘Double Data (2X)’ offer across all its BigTime Data bundles.
With the new 'BigTime Xtra' bundles, customers will enjoy double data benefits with No Expiry for the same price.
For instance, the ¢10 data bundle offered 1.5GB with No Expiry, but with the New 'BigTime Xtra' bundle, the customer will now get 3GB data for the same price.
Customers can also subscribe to the bundles by dialling the AirtelTigo’s One-Stop-Shop.
Furthermore, customers get even more value when they bundle through AirtelTigo Money (ATM).
For instance, the same ¢10 BigTime Xtra Bundle offers 4GB as against 3GB when bundled via AirtelTigo Money.
Speaking about the new offer, Atul Narain Singh, the Chief Marketing Officer at AirtelTigo, said, “We are constantly innovating to provide a superior experience and great value to our customers.
"With the customers need to stay online round the clock, we have redefined data value proposition with the new 'BigTime Xtra' data bundles”.
He also spoke about the recently launched 'Unlimited Call Bundles' which allows customers to enjoy unlimited AirtelTigo calls for a specified amount they purchase.
